u/stuipd 19d ago
Why not titanium?
2
u/super-kuper 19d ago
The advantage of titanium is that it’s lighter weight, the disadvantage is that it has a lower heat resistance and durability for rapid fire. Shooting full auto or FRT on a titanium can will heat it up and ablate the material faster than an equivalent inconel or stainless or Haynes can.
